Answer:
Joe's heart beats approximately 66 times in 60 seconds.
Explanation:
To find out how many times Joe's heart beats in 60 seconds, we can set up a proportion using the given information.
Let's define the following variables:
x = number of heart beats in 60 seconds
We know that Joe's heart beats 11 times in 10 seconds. We can set up the proportion:
11 beats / 10 seconds = x beats / 60 seconds
To solve this proportion, we can cross multiply:
10 * x = 11 * 60
10x = 660
Divide both sides of the equation by 10 to isolate x:
x = 660 / 10
x = 66
